Quick Facts — Elk Mound village

What is the median household income in Elk Mound village?
The median household income in Elk Mound village is $62,167 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023).
What is the poverty rate in Elk Mound village?
The poverty rate in Elk Mound village is 15.1% (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the median home value in Elk Mound village?
$142,500 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the average rent in Elk Mound village?
The median gross rent in Elk Mound village is $984 per month (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What percentage of Elk Mound village residents have a college degree?
22.8% of adults in Elk Mound village hold a bachelor's degree or higher (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
